Analysis of the Psychological Impact of Tiktok on Contemporary Teenagers
NingBo YinZhou High School, Ningbo, China, 31500
* Corresponding author: lz1621601944@gmail.com
With the development of information technology, short video has become an important part of people’s leisure life. Among them, Tiktok is the largest and fastest-growing application in the short video market, with about 1.5 billion users worldwide. Unlike other software, Tikotok’s users are mostly teenagers, but the contents on Tiktok are varied and even contain a lot of violence and pornography. So the psychological impact of this software on contemporary teenagers is huge. By analyzing high school students’ use of Tiktok data and the positive and negative effects of Tiktok on high school students’ psychology, this paper puts forward suggestions to help families, schools and governments take measures, and draw their attention to the mental health of contemporary adolescents and promote their physical and mental health, so as to promote the healthy growth of teenagers.
